Colonel Thomas Henry Sebag-Montefiore1 
He was educated at Clifton College, Clifton, Bristol, EnglandG.1 He was educated at Royal Military Academy, Woolwich, Kent, EnglandG.1 He was commissioned in 1906, in the service of the Royal Artillery.1 He gained the rank of Captain in 1914.1 He fought in the First World War between 1914 and 1919, in France, Belgium, Italy and Germany.1 He gained the rank of Major in 1917.1 He was awarded the Distinguished Service Order (D.S.O.)1 He was awarded the Military Cross (M.C.)1 He gained the rank of Brevet Lieutenant-Colonel in 1932.1 He gained the rank of Lieutenant-Colonel in 1934.1 He was commander of the 1st Regiment, Royal Horse Artillery.1 He fought in the Second World War.1 He was Commandant of the 125 OCTU, Royal Artillery between 1939 and 1944.1

Sir Leonard Lionel Cohen1 
He was educated at King’s College School, Wimbledon, London, England.1 He was member of the Jewish Board of Guardians between 1888 and 1920.1 He was director of Bengal and NW Railway and Rohilkund and Kumaon Railway.4 He was member of the Committee Stock Exchange between 1896 and 1904.1 He was partner of Louis Cohen and Sons, foreign bankers and of Stock Exchange till its dissolution before 1901.1 He was appointed Knight Commander, Royal Victorian Order (K.C.V.O.) in 1930.1 He lived at Wellingrove, Rickmansworth, Hertfordshire, EnglandG.4
